K-POCHA is a concept bar a Korean nightlife theme. The bar introduces a lot of Korean drinking game cultures to Hong Kong. Customers may try the drinking games or just enjoy the beer pong and darts.

K-POCHA introduces 5 popular drinking games, "007 Bang", "Jan-Chigi", "Titanic", "Nunchi" and "Thumb Up". The instructions of the drinking games are on the drinking menus, while the staff may share their tips with you if you are kind enough!

Korean Rice Wine (Makgeolli) ($150/jug)

Housemade Korean Rice Wine took a week to brew to enhance the aroma and flavour. It was so sweet and warming that it was almost addictive. By the way, K-POCHA only serves this in limited supply every night so remember to come early! We would definitely be back just because of this Makgeolli!

Korean Egg Roll ($90)

A traditional Korean egg dish that is prepared with freshly imported Korean eggs, spring onions ,carrots and filled with light cheddar cheese. It was light in flavour and we liked how flurry the egg wraps and the fillings were.

K-Pocha Fried Whole Chicken ($188)

Classic Korean dish to enjoy when drinking. The crispy fried chicken is served with pickled radish and three sauces (hot pepper paste, chili sauce and salt& pepper). How can you resist the crispy skins?

If you buy a drink during Happy Hour time, you may get half of a fried chicken for FREE!

Spicy Seafood Rice Cake (Dukboki) ($180)

The seafood dukboki was prepared with shrimps, mussels, and octopus, topped with chopped spring onions and a layer of melted cheese. The Dukboki was chewy but not too chewy, it was also slightly spicy but not too hot to handle. It was kind of non-stopable once you have started eating this.
